# THIS FILE IS AUTOMATICALLY GENERATED BY CARGO # # When uploading crates to the registry Cargo will automatically # "normalize" Cargo.toml files for maximal compatibility # with all versions of Cargo and also rewrite `path` dependencies # to registry (e.g., crates.io) dependencies. # # If you are reading this file be aware that the original Cargo.toml # will likely look very different (and much more reasonable). # See Cargo.toml.orig for the original contents. [package] edition = "2021" name = "rust_hls" version = "0.2.0" authors = ["zebreus "] description = "Support crate for rust_hls" homepage = "https://github.com/zebreus/bachelor-thesis/tree/master/bambu-macro/rust_hls" readme = "README" keywords = [ "verilog", "fpga", "hls", "high-level-synthesis", "bambu", ] categories = [ "development-tools::build-utils", "compilers", ] license = "MIT OR Apache-2.0" repository = "https://github.com/zebreus/bachelor-thesis" resolver = "1" [dependencies.base64] version = "0.21.0" [dependencies.cargo_toml] version = "0.15.2" [dependencies.clap] version = "4.3.4" features = ["derive"] [dependencies.convert_case] version = "0.6.0" [dependencies.darling] version = "0.20.1" [dependencies.derive_builder] version = "0.12.0" [dependencies.directories] version = "5.0.0" [dependencies.extract_rust_hdl_interface] version = "0.2.0" [dependencies.fs_extra] version = "1.3.0" [dependencies.fslock] version = "0.2.1" [dependencies.glob] version = "0.3.1" [dependencies.itertools] version = "0.10.5" [dependencies.merkle_hash] version = "3.5.0" [dependencies.prettyplease] version = "0.2.6" default-features = false [dependencies.proc-macro2] version = "1.0.60" features = ["span-locations"] [dependencies.quote] version = "1.0.28" default-features = false [dependencies.rand] version = "0.8.5" [dependencies.regex] version = "1.8.4" [dependencies.rust_hls_macro_lib] version = "0.1.0" [dependencies.serde] version = "1.0.160" [dependencies.spanned_error_message] version = "0.1.0" [dependencies.syn] version = "2.0.18" features = [ "full", "parsing", "extra-traits", "printing", "clone-impls", "derive", "visit", "visit-mut", "fold", ] default-features = false [dependencies.tempfile] version = "3.5.0" [dependencies.thiserror] version = "1.0.40" [dependencies.toml] version = "0.7.3" [dependencies.verilated] version = "0.1.0" optional = true [dependencies.verilated-module] version = "0.1.0" optional = true [dependencies.verilator] version = "0.1.0" features = [ "gen", "module", ] optional = true [dev-dependencies.rust_hls_macro] version = "0.2.0" [features] default = ["verilator"] verilator = [ "dep:verilator", "dep:verilated", "dep:verilated-module", ]